What's happening?

Video Sources 15 Views Report Error

  • VidSrc

The Secret of Skinwalker Ranch: 4x10

A Frequency Occurrence

When an indigenous sound ritual is performed on Skinwalker Ranch, the team is amazed by the phenomena that are revealed.

Jun. 27, 2023